More info "This looks like a crime scene," I said to my pal as I held a Vanilla Lavender Ice Whipped Latte up to snap a photo, grimacing. A greyish gloopy fluid formed the bottom layer in the clear cup, topped with thin milky liquid and finished off with unctuous, foamy beige. In reality it was a vanilla lavender syrup, complemented with milk and an ice whipped coffee topping, but I couldn't help but think terrible thoughts as it all sloshed around with chunks of ice disturbing it all. I'm already at risk of hyperactivity anyway, so they might as well make the lavender syrup purple, instead of a hue comparible to a cold nan's ankles? The drink isn't on the menu yet, launching officially on Thursday, May 8, but app users get exclusive access for two weeks, so I took advantage and ordered. I gave it a good mix, unwilling to cop a gobful of syrup given there was a high chance it would taste of pot pourri. Reader, it didn't. It was a million times better, not that I've ever made a habit of licking pot pourri. The lavender flavour is subtle, tasting more on the side of a particularly fresh midsummer blueberry than a Parma Violet-style perfume. The coffee holds its bitter notes and the vanilla gives it all an indulgent, decadent element. I've been critical of Costa in the past for the violently saccharine drinks (remember the hot milkshakes or the Kit Kat coffee?) but this drink isn't as heavy on the syrup, which I really enjoyed; it reminded me, a little bit, of that blueberry matcha drink I love from Blank Street Coffee. It might be the ugliest drink Costa has had on its menu in a while, but the Vanilla Lavender Ice Whipped Latte is the best one too. All it needs is a colourful sleeve to cover up the fact that it looks like a crime scene and Costa is on to a winner!
